What you'll be doing Build and develop comprehensive training programs for new hires, process updates, and system improvements.
Build and deliver engaging training materials, including presentations, handouts, and online resources. Collaborate with subject matter experts to ensure training content accuracy. Implement evaluation methods to audit training efficiency and recommend ongoing training.
Provide feedback and mentor on performance issues through quality assessments. Maintain a well-documented quality program. Distribute quality communications to the Customer Service Organization.
Collaborate with Process Owners on SOP documentation and quality systems. What you'll bring Bachelor’s degree in Education, Training and Development, or equivalent experience. More than 3 years of background in Customer Service or adult education.
Proficiency in CRM systems and ERP platforms (e.g., JDE, SAP). Excellent communication, interpersonal, critical thinking, and problem-solving skills. Proven ability to prioritise multiple tasks in a fast-paced environment.
Advanced proficiency in Microsoft Office (Word, Excel, Outlook). Demonstrated ability to lead and collaborate within cross-functional teams. Preferred: Certified Professional in Learning and Performance (CPLP) or Certified Training Professional (CTP) certification.
Experience with training management systems and learning management systems. Project management or Lean Six Sigma certification (Blue Belt or higher). Bilingual or multilingual communication skills.
